I am currently trying to deploy Graylog with a cloudStor volume attached to graylog_journal.

The graylog service refuse to start due to permission error.

Graylog currently runs with user Id 1100. How do i set the volume permission to allow for user 1100 to access the cloudStor volume?

Error Message from docker

ERROR: Unable to access file /usr/share/graylog/data/journal/graylog2-committed-read-offset: Permission denied
